Chocolate creation is a multi-stage process that requires balance between temperature, texture, and timing. Each element must align perfectly to achieve a smooth and appealing result. Modern machinery supports this harmony through careful control systems that allow each stage—mixing, refining, conching, and tempering—to maintain precision. This consistency ensures that every chocolate piece carries the same sensory experience that defines its identity.
Manufacturers now focus on efficiency without losing craftsmanship. Equipment designed with flexibility in mind adapts easily to new recipes or production scales. Whether producing bars, chips, or coatings, adaptable systems enable faster transitions between product types, saving time while preserving quality. This adaptability has become essential in responding to shifting consumer preferences and seasonal production demands.
Sanitation and safety standards have also become critical design priorities. Machines built with smooth surfaces, accessible parts, and easy-clean structures ensure hygiene without disrupting workflow. These thoughtful design features contribute not only to product safety but also to the longevity of the machinery itself, creating dependable systems that serve both small and large producers effectively.
Automation is reshaping the confectionery landscape. Integrated control panels, digital monitoring, and programmable settings give operators better oversight while minimizing manual intervention. This digital evolution enables consistent production with fewer variables, supporting both innovation and reliability. It also reduces human error, helping manufacturers maintain steady product quality from batch to batch.
Sustainability, too, has found its place within chocolate processing. Modern systems now focus on reducing waste, optimizing energy usage, and promoting efficient resource management. These enhancements align industrial performance with environmental responsibility, reflecting a growing awareness of sustainable production practices across global markets.
